Horizon Forbidden West could be delayed to 2022

Horizon Forbidden West, the sequel to Horizon Zero Dawn was supposed to release in the second half of 2021 but now seemingly could be delayed to 2022.

After the game’s tease back in 2020 there have been no big development updates from the developers yet. Back in November 2020, a PlayStation trailer revealed the release window for several PlayStation titles including Horizon Forbidden West.

PlayStation trailer shows Horizon Forbidden West to be released in second half of 2021

A recent tweet by Vadim Elistratov says that games like Overwatch 2, Hogwarts Legacies, Gran Turismo 7 and more won’t be releasing this year. Popular YouTuber Anton Logvinov replied to the tweet talking about Horizon Forbidden West.

The tweet is in Russian and so is the reply, but a Resetra user (PS9) translated Anton’s reply which says “I would add Horizon to that list too”. It seems like Horizon Forbidden West will be delayed to next year, as the leak comes from a fairly reputable source. Anton was the first to leak that Horizon Zero Dawn would make its way to PC, so he could be right about this too.

Seeing the example of Cyberpunk 2077, it seems like no developer wants to hurry into releasing a game before it is completely ready, which of course is a good thing.

Horizon Forbidden West is still scheduled for a late 2021 release as the developers haven’t officially made any statements about a possible delay. Still, it is likely that the game will be delayed considering the challenges introduced due to the COVID-19 pandemic have significantly affected the work pace of game development companies.
